Last week, Kanye West debuted his music video for “New Slaves” by projecting it across the fronts of buildings around the world. But while Paris, Berlin and Chicago all agreed to be in on the rapper’s latest act, Houston apparently had a problem with whatever West had planned for Friday night at the Rothko Chapel. Local reports confirm that authorities pulled up to that location – after West announced the gathering via Twitter hours before – and threatened to arrest all attendees for trespassing. The crowd soon dispersed once it became clear that no video would be shown. Kanye West – “New Slaves” (Music Video) West’s new album, “Yeezus,” drops on June 18. A gunman went on a shooting spree in central Texas early yesterday morning, authorities now confirm, leaving five people injured and one dead before being killed himself in a shootout with police. One of the wounded was a Concho County sheriff. The unnamed 23-year North Carolina resident was tracked by nine state and local agencies across two counties for nearly two hours, opening fire from his pickup truck and hitting random cars along the way. He was eventually killed along a highway north of Eden by a state trooper and a game warden. Upon approaching his corpse, law enforcement officials noted that he was armed an assault-style rifle, a handgun and hundreds of rounds of ammunition. No other details were released, but investigators say only they are reviewing “multiple crime scenes.”
